A 20-year-old man has admitted to the rape of a boy aged under 16.

James Bright, of Strathy Close, Reading, pleaded guilty to the charge on the first day of his trial at Reading Crown Court on Monday, June 9.

At about 7pm on January 9, 2013, Bright asked a 13-year-old boy into an alleyway off Alphington Road, where he raped him.

Bright was arrested later that day and was charged on August 2, 2013.

Investigating officer, DC Pauline Cameron, from Reading Force CID, said: “This was a horrendous crime inflicted on a vulnerable young boy.

“I am glad the case is now over and the family can start to concentrate on rebuilding their lives.”

Bright is due to be sentenced on August 22.
